Suspect due in court tomorrow
A man's been charged in connection with several thefts in the capital this week.
Police say the 31 year old suspect was arrested following a burglary at the 'Top Shop' convenience store in Pulrose, and the linked theft of two vehicles.
He's also been charged with several motoring offences, and will appear in court tomorrow morning.
Detective Sergeant Bobby Syme says the thefts were all 'preventable', and is urging residents to remain considerate of basic security measures.
There's also been a renewed appeal for information concerning the burglary, which took place around 7am on Thursday morning, and is thought to have involved a black Mitsibishi Shogun 4x4 vehicle.
